"textContent": "A safe passing system for a vehicle includes: a road ambient environment sensing system (), configured to obtain sensing information of a road ambient environment in real time, process the sensing information to obtain vehicle driving assistance information, and send the vehicle driving assistance information to a vehicle-mounted terminal (); and the vehicle-mounted terminal (), configured to receive the vehicle driving assistance information, and plan a driving route according to the vehicle driving assistance information and vehicle-acquired information.",
"title": "SAFE PASSING SYSTEM AND METHOD FOR VEHICLE"
